Problem
Current security systems in financial institutions and other businesses are inadequate in detecting and investigating internal fraud and illegal activities, as they primarily focus on external threats and lack the ability to analyze communication data from multiple sources in real-time, leading to delayed detection and increased damage.
Innovation Solution
A system that collects and analyzes communication data from multiple sources, including telephone, email, and instant messaging activity, using a correlation tool to identify patterns and trends, and outputs reports that can assist internal and external security personnel in investigating potential fraud rings.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Reliability
If security systems focus on external access attempts, then external threats are detected, but internal fraud activities remain undetected for long periods
Solution Approach 1:
The monitoring system is segmented into multiple specialized components: telephone dialed digit data collection, email transmission data collection, and correlation analysis tools. Each component handles specific data types independently, allowing the system to detect both external and internal fraud activities simultaneously without compromise to detection reliability or coverage versatility
Solution Approach 2:
The correlation analysis tool serves multiple functions: it analyzes telephone data, email data, and correlates both data types together to identify fraud patterns. This multi-functional approach enables the system to detect various fraud types including internal fraud rings, achieving both reliable detection and versatile coverage
2Quantity of substance
If communication data is collected at predetermined time intervals, then data storage requirements are reduced, but investigation timing is delayed
Solution Approach 1:
The system performs preliminary continuous collection and analysis of communication data from telephone and email sources, maintaining current data availability without lengthy waits. This preliminary action ensures investigation personnel can immediately retrieve relevant communication records when fraud is suspected, eliminating investigation delays while managing data storage through efficient correlation analysis
3Device complexity
If single data source analysis is used, then analysis complexity is reduced, but fraud pattern detection accuracy decreases
Solution Approach 1:
The correlation analysis tool merges telephone dialed digit data with email transmission data, analyzing both data sources together to identify communication sequences and patterns involving multiple types of communications. This combining approach significantly improves fraud detection accuracy by revealing cross-platform fraud patterns that single-source analysis would miss, while managing complexity through integrated correlation rules

Communication data for an organization, such as call, email, and instant messaging activity data from different data sources is collected and analyzed together using a correlation and behavior analysis tool. A set of communication activity records and/or specific contact data information may be provided by the organization's data sources or by an external law enforcement entity. The organization data may be analyzed according to rules and policies of data analysis and correlation using the multiple data sources to identify and report related communication activity or contact data to the internal personnel or external law enforcement for continued investigation in tracking fraud rings and other illegal activities.
